How many people live in Mesa, Arizona?
Mesa, Arizona has about 396,375 residents according to the 2000 Census.
What is the median household income in Mesa, Arizona?
The typical household in Mesa, Arizona earns about $42,817 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Mesa, Arizona expensive?
In Mesa, Arizona, the median home is worth about $112,100, and the typical rent is about $669 a month.
How educated are people in Mesa, Arizona?
About 21.6% of adults age 25 and over in Mesa, Arizona h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Mesa, Arizona?
About 8.9% of people in Mesa, Arizona live below the federal poverty line.
Has Mesa, Arizona grown since 1990?
Yes, Mesa, Arizona has grown since 1990. The population has added about 108,284 residents, a change of about 38 percent over that period.
